Luca 9f3b28684f feat(accounting): scope the tax-report export to income-only or cost-only
Adds a Complete / Income only / Cost only selector to the readable PDF + CSV
export (the on-screen report stays complete). Income-only emits just the
outgoing rows + the income summary line (+ the per-rate breakdown in the PDF);
cost-only emits the incoming-invoice + expense rows + the cost line and drops
the income-by-rate breakdown. Useful in Liechtenstein where, under the income
threshold, a flat 20% Gewinnungskosten deduction is sometimes better than actual
costs — handing the Treuhänder just the income (or just the cost) basis is
cleaner.

Backend: renderTaxReportPdf/Csv take a `scope` param (all|income|cost) that
filters report.ledger by row.type + the summary lines; the /pdf + /csv routes
accept & validate `?scope=`; filenames get an income_/cost_ tag. Frontend:
scope <select> beside the export buttons, threaded through buildQueryString.
i18n en/de. The 20% calculation itself is intentionally NOT in-app (applied by
the Treuhänder) per the scoping decision.
